Why is specialized centrifugal honey extraction equipment necessary? Boost Yield and Protect Bee Colonies


Specialized centrifugal honey extraction equipment is essential for modern beekeeping because it utilizes rotational force to separate liquid honey from the comb without destroying the delicate wax structure. By keeping the honeycomb intact, this method allows beekeepers to return the frames to the hive for immediate reuse, significantly reducing the biological stress on the colony and boosting production efficiency.

The Core Takeaway The primary value of centrifugal extraction is not just mechanical speed, but biological conservation. By preserving the honeycomb structure, you eliminate the massive energy cost bees incur to secrete new wax, directly converting that saved energy into higher honey yields and shorter production cycles.

The Mechanics of Preservation

Non-Destructive Separation

Unlike traditional "crush and strain" or pressing methods, centrifugal extractors use high-speed rotation to generate centrifugal force.

This force pulls the liquid honey out of the cells and onto the walls of the extractor. Crucially, this process occurs without damaging the physical structure of the wax comb.

Elimination of Structural Waste

Manual methods often result in the destruction of the comb, turning it into a byproduct that must be processed separately.

Centrifugal equipment ensures the frame remains structurally sound. The wax matrix is emptied of its contents but retains its shape, ready for immediate reintroduction to the hive.

The Biological and Economic Impact

Reducing the "Wax Tax" on Bees

Bees consume a significant amount of honey and energy to secrete the wax needed to build honeycombs.

When you return intact combs to the hive, you save the colony from this energy-intensive rebuilding process. This conservation of energy is critical for maintaining the continuity of colony production.

Shortening Production Cycles

Because the bees do not need to rebuild the comb from scratch, they can immediately begin filling the empty cells with fresh nectar.

This drastically shortens the turnaround time between harvests. In regions with short flowering seasons, this efficiency is a vital technical safeguard for maximizing output.

Increasing Annual Yield

The direct correlation between comb reuse and yield is significant. By minimizing the energy spent on construction, the colony's resources are redirected toward nectar gathering and honey storage.

Quality Control and Hygiene

Minimizing Contamination

Centrifugal extraction reduces the need for direct human contact with the honey.

By mechanizing the separation process, the equipment minimizes the risk of introducing bacteria or foreign debris, ensuring a higher standard of hygiene and safety for the final product.

Ensuring Product Purity

Efficient filtration is often integrated into or pairs with extraction systems.

This minimizes honey loss during harvesting and ensures the final product is free of wax particles and impurities, adhering to higher commercial standards than manual pressing.

Understanding the Trade-offs

The Requirement for Uncapping

Centrifugal force cannot extract honey from sealed cells.

Beekeepers must understand that this equipment requires a preparatory step: the frames must be uncapped (the wax seal removed) before spinning. This adds a step to the workflow compared to simple crushing, though the efficiency gains outweigh this cost.

Equipment Complexity

While manual pressing is low-tech, centrifugal extractors represent a move toward industrialized processing.

This requires an investment in specialized machinery and potentially a power source for high-speed rotation. However, for operations focused on volume and efficiency, this complexity is a necessary exchange for the resulting speed and yield.
